The last time I went to Whistler was for an anniversary and it was a total fine dining/drinking trip. We hit up Rimrock, Bearfoot and Elements in the three evenings we had there, and the trip previous we did Araxi.

Another I would add is Elements Urban Bistro. It's a totally casual tapas bar but the food is great; one of the best 'bites' of the trip (mushroom-truffle croquette).

I echo all of lowside's sentiments on Bearfoot, though I can see how it may be more 'snooty' or 'overbearing' for people who are used to a more casual experience. It is more 'old-school' fine dining, the room itself and ambiance definitely feels more formal than even Araxi. If you've never tried it, the table-side nitro ice cream is awesome and worth the supplement (though if you've had nitro ice-cream before it before I wouldn't bother).

Also +1 for Rimrock; also great, more casual than Araxi and Bearfoot.
